Light Out ?

I have a front headlight low beam out on my 06 but no light out indicator. Do both the high AND low have to be burned out to get the indicator?

Mystery solved.

It turns out that the filament had burned in two. The ends, however, were still making contact. This allowed the control module to sense continuity but the filament would not glow.

New bulb and I'm back in business.
